Writing a dissertation can be a long and challenging process. Here are some tips to help you stay on track and complete your dissertation on time:

1. Set Realistic Goals

Break down your dissertation into smaller, manageable tasks, and set realistic goals for each one. This will help you stay motivated and focused throughout the process.

 

2. Create a Schedule

Create a schedule that includes time for research, writing, and revision. Stick to this schedule as much as possible to ensure that you make steady progress.

 

3. Stay Organized

Keep all of your research notes, drafts, and other materials organized and easily accessible. This will help you stay on top of your work and avoid wasting time looking for information.

 

4. Seek Feedback

Ask your advisor and other mentors for feedback on your work throughout the process. This will help you identify areas for improvement and make necessary adjustments.

 

5. Take Breaks

Writing a dissertation can be mentally and emotionally exhausting. Take breaks as needed to rest and recharge, and don’t forget to take care of yourself during the process.

1. Can you write a dissertation in a month?

It is highly unlikely that you can write a dissertation in a month. Writing a dissertation requires significant time and effort, and it is essential to take the necessary time to conduct research, analyze data, and write your dissertation.

2. How many pages is a dissertation?

The number of pages in a dissertation can vary widely depending on the research topic, methodology, and other factors. Generally, a dissertation is between 150 and 300 pages.

3. How many hours a day should you write your dissertation?

The number of hours you should spend writing your dissertation can vary depending on your personal circumstances and the scope of your project. Generally, it is recommended to spend at least two to three hours a day writing your dissertation.

4. How often should you meet with your dissertation advisor?

The frequency of meetings with your dissertation advisor can vary depending on your personal circumstances and the availability of your advisor. Generally, it is recommended to meet with your advisor at least once a month to discuss your progress and receive feedback on your work.
